摘要
In this work, we present a modified three-stage sampling procedure to construct fixed-width confidence intervals of the common variance of equicorrelated normal distributions. We derive the exact distribution of the stopping variable of this sampling scheme and also the exact distribution of the estimator of the common variance at stopping. The modified three-stage sampling substantially reduces the expected sample size compared to that of the two-stage sampling scheme of Haner and Zacks (2013). The coverage probabilities of the proposed interval estimators are computed exactly and are compared with the coverage probabilities obtained by two-stage sampling. We derive exact formulae for the functionals of the stopping variable and the estimator of the common variance at stopping.
